PIA Client Service Associate Work Location
Fredericton, New Brunswick, Canada
Hours37.5 hours per week
Line Of BusinessTD Wealth
Pay Details$38,300 - $51,700 CAD annually
Job DescriptionTD Private Wealth Management takes a sophisticated, holistic approach to wealth planning and protection to provide highly personalized advice, solutions, and service to clients. You will provide dedicated specialized administrative support to an Investment Advisor or team of Advisors on diverse assignments.
Responsibilities- Prepare documentation and provide updates to IAs in preparation for client meetings
- Create reports for analysis of client accounts; communicate with customers to provide mentorship on products and services, and identify referral opportunities
- Accept/create leads and ensure correct referral coding administration
- Submit marketing pieces for approval, compile client information packages, maintain marketing materials
- Become familiar with and adhere to compliance requirements, including all aspects of new and existing account documentation and marketing materials
- Provide a high level of client service which includes responding to phone, mail and electronic enquiries based on knowledge of full service brokerage
- Deliver the 'gold standard' client experience at every interaction with team members, colleagues and clients; prioritize and handle own work and consistently exercise discretion
- Adhere to all policies and procedures and maintain a culture and operation of risk management
- Use insights to continually improve individual and team performance for clients
- Participate fully as a team member, continually improve knowledge and keep others informed and up to date about status and progress, issues or other related activities
- Undergraduate degree or community college diploma preferred
- Willingness to complete the Canadian Securities Course (CSC) and Conduct and Practices Handbook (CPH) to become licensed with the Canadian Investment Regulatory Organization (CIRO) within 6 months.
- Strong communication skills with ability to build relationships and work collaboratively, confidentially and independently
